COMPARATIVE ANALYSIS OF POSSIBILITIES AND CONDITIONS OF APPLICATION OF CONCEPTS "2D → 3D" AND "3D → 2D" IN DESIGN ACTIVITIES

Shvetsova Viktoria Viktorovna  (Candidate of Technical Sciences, Docent Department Descriptive Geometry and Engineering Graphics University Saint-Petersburg State University Architecture and Civil Engineering )

Leonova Olga Nikolaevna  (Candidate of Technical Sciences, Docent Department Descriptive Geometry and Engineering Graphics University Saint-Petersburg State University Architecture and Civil Engineering )

The article contains issues related to design procedures and presentation formats of the results at the design (architectural and construction) solutions. The requirements of modern regulatory and technical documents regarding the composition and presentation at the design documentation are considered. The analysis at the genesis of automation for design procedures was carried out and characteristics of the levels states in digital (information) technologies at the modern architectural and construction activities are presented. The impact of the quality for design information platforms on the efficiency of design development is shown. Characteristic features for the use in the concepts of "2D→3D" and "2D→3D" design as the main formats of representations the design solutions have been identified.

Keywords:architectural and construction facilities, design activities, information technologies, design documentation, formats presentation the results, methods and techniques, regulatory and technical documents, genesis of automation design procedures, state levels
